Following a recent trademark battle win for Australia’s honey industry over using the term “Manuka”, honey brand Capilano has launched two new products: Capilano Active Manuka Honey MGO 100+ and Capilano Active Honey MGO 550+.
Compared to traditional honey, the Manuka variety contains the bioactive ingredient methylglyoxal (MGO), which is responsible for the honey’s antibacterial, anti-inflammatory and wound-healing properties. The higher the MGO, the more potent the honey’s bioactive properties.
The company describe its Active Manuka Honey MGO 100+ as having a rich, smooth caramel taste and is recommended for everyday use. While the Active Manuka Honey MGO 550+ is its most potent formulation, recommended for wound healing, skincare, and to soothe a sore, scratchy throat.
